Project ROI Calculator
Calculate the return on investment for your project with precise financial metrics
Comprehensive Guide: How to Calculate ROI for a Project
Return on Investment (ROI) is the most critical financial metric for evaluating the profitability of any business project. This comprehensive guide will walk you through the essential components of ROI calculation, advanced methodologies, and practical applications to ensure you make data-driven investment decisions.
1. Understanding the Fundamentals of ROI
ROI measures the gain or loss generated on an investment relative to the amount of money invested. The basic ROI formula is:
ROI = (Net Profit / Cost of Investment) × 100%
Where:
- Net Profit = Total Revenue – Total Costs
- Cost of Investment = Initial capital expenditure
2. Key Components of Project ROI Calculation
To calculate ROI accurately, you need to consider these essential elements:
- Initial Investment: The upfront capital required to start the project (equipment, software, real estate, etc.)
- Operating Costs: Ongoing expenses (salaries, utilities, maintenance, etc.)
- Revenue Streams: All income generated by the project
- Time Horizon: The duration over which you’ll measure returns
- Discount Rate: Accounts for the time value of money (typically your required rate of return)
- Tax Implications: How taxes affect your net profits
3. Advanced ROI Calculation Methods
While the basic ROI formula is useful, professional financial analysis requires more sophisticated approaches:
| Method | Description | Best For | Formula |
|---|---|---|---|
| Net Present Value (NPV) | Calculates the present value of all future cash flows | Long-term projects with variable cash flows | NPV = Σ [CFt / (1+r)^t] – Initial Investment |
| Internal Rate of Return (IRR) | The discount rate that makes NPV zero | Comparing projects of different durations | 0 = Σ [CFt / (1+IRR)^t] – Initial Investment |
| Payback Period | Time required to recover the initial investment | Quick assessment of liquidity risk | Years before cumulative cash flow turns positive |
| Profitability Index | Ratio of present value of future cash flows to initial investment | Capital rationing decisions | PI = PV of Future Cash Flows / Initial Investment |
4. Step-by-Step ROI Calculation Process
Follow this professional workflow to calculate ROI for any project:
-
Define Project Scope
- Clearly outline all components of the project
- Identify all revenue streams and cost centers
- Establish the project timeline (short-term vs. long-term)
-
Gather Financial Data
- Initial investment requirements (CapEx)
- Operating expenses (OpEx) for each period
- Projected revenue for each period
- Applicable tax rates and depreciation schedules
-
Calculate Cash Flows
- For each period: Revenue – Expenses – Taxes = Net Cash Flow
- Include working capital changes if applicable
- Account for salvage value at project end
-
Apply Time Value of Money
- Discount all future cash flows using your required rate of return
- Use the formula: PV = FV / (1 + r)^n
- Sum all discounted cash flows to get NPV
-
Calculate ROI Metrics
- Basic ROI = (NPV / Initial Investment) × 100%
- Calculate IRR using financial functions or iterative methods
- Determine payback period from cumulative cash flows
-
Sensitivity Analysis
- Test how changes in key variables affect ROI
- Create best-case, worst-case, and most-likely scenarios
- Identify the most critical success factors
5. Common ROI Calculation Mistakes to Avoid
Even experienced professionals make these critical errors when calculating ROI:
- Ignoring the Time Value of Money: Not discounting future cash flows leads to overestimated returns. Always use NPV calculations for multi-year projects.
- Overlooking Hidden Costs: Forgetting to include training, implementation, or opportunity costs can significantly skew results.
- Being Overly Optimistic: Using best-case scenarios for revenue and worst-case for costs creates misleading ROI figures.
- Neglecting Tax Implications: Taxes can reduce net returns by 20-40%. Always calculate after-tax cash flows.
- Using Inconsistent Time Periods: Comparing projects with different durations without annualizing returns leads to incorrect comparisons.
- Forgetting Working Capital: Changes in inventory, receivables, and payables affect cash flow but are often overlooked.
- Disregarding Risk: Not adjusting the discount rate for project-specific risks can understate the true cost of capital.
6. Industry-Specific ROI Considerations
Different industries have unique factors that affect ROI calculations:
| Industry | Key ROI Factors | Typical ROI Range | Average Payback Period |
|---|---|---|---|
| Technology/Software | Development costs, subscription models, churn rates, scalability | 150-400% | 2-4 years |
| Manufacturing | Equipment costs, production efficiency, economies of scale | 50-150% | 3-7 years |
| Real Estate | Property appreciation, rental yields, maintenance costs, leverage | 8-12% annually | 5-10 years |
| Retail | Inventory turnover, foot traffic, seasonal variations, e-commerce integration | 30-100% | 1-3 years |
| Healthcare | Regulatory compliance, insurance reimbursements, patient volume | 20-80% | 3-5 years |
7. Tools and Resources for ROI Calculation
Professional tools can significantly improve the accuracy and efficiency of your ROI calculations:
- Spreadsheet Software: Microsoft Excel or Google Sheets with financial functions (NPV, IRR, XNPV, XIRR)
- Financial Calculators: HP 12C, Texas Instruments BA II Plus
- Project Management Software: Tools like Smartsheet or Monday.com with ROI tracking features
- BI Tools: Tableau or Power BI for visualizing ROI scenarios
- Online Calculators: Specialized ROI calculators for different industries
For authoritative guidance on financial calculations, refer to these resources:
- SEC Guide on ROI Calculations for Investment Advisers
- Corporate Finance Institute ROI Guide
- Investopedia ROI Definition and Calculation
- SBA Guide to Financial Projections in Business Plans
8. Real-World ROI Calculation Example
Let’s examine a practical example for a manufacturing equipment upgrade:
- Initial Investment: $250,000 (new machinery)
- Annual Savings: $75,000 (reduced labor and maintenance costs)
- Additional Revenue: $50,000 (increased production capacity)
- Project Duration: 8 years
- Salvage Value: $30,000 (equipment resale value)
- Discount Rate: 12% (company’s WACC)
- Tax Rate: 25%
Year-by-Year Cash Flow Analysis:
| Year | Gross Savings | Taxes (25%) | Net Savings | Discount Factor (12%) | Present Value |
|---|---|---|---|---|---|
| 0 | ($250,000) | $0 | ($250,000) | 1.000 | ($250,000) |
| 1 | $125,000 | ($31,250) | $93,750 | 0.893 | $83,606 |
| 2 | $125,000 | ($31,250) | $93,750 | 0.797 | $74,650 |
| 3 | $125,000 | ($31,250) | $93,750 | 0.712 | $66,652 |
| 4 | $125,000 | ($31,250) | $93,750 | 0.636 | $59,510 |
| 5 | $125,000 | ($31,250) | $93,750 | 0.567 | $53,134 |
| 6 | $125,000 | ($31,250) | $93,750 | 0.507 | $47,423 |
| 7 | $125,000 | ($31,250) | $93,750 | 0.452 | $42,342 |
| 8 | $155,000 | ($38,750) | $116,250 | 0.404 | $46,977 |
| Total | $62,394 |
Key Metrics:
- NPV: $62,394 (positive NPV indicates the project is profitable)
- ROI: 25% ($62,394 NPV / $250,000 investment)
- IRR: 14.8% (calculated using financial functions)
- Payback Period: 3.2 years
9. Improving Your Project’s ROI
Once you’ve calculated your baseline ROI, consider these strategies to enhance returns:
-
Optimize Cost Structure
- Negotiate better terms with suppliers
- Implement lean methodologies to reduce waste
- Automate repetitive processes
- Outsource non-core functions
-
Enhance Revenue Streams
- Develop premium offerings or add-on services
- Implement dynamic pricing strategies
- Expand into new markets or customer segments
- Create subscription or recurring revenue models
-
Accelerate Time-to-Market
- Use agile development methodologies
- Prioritize minimum viable products (MVPs)
- Streamline approval processes
- Leverage existing platforms or partnerships
-
Improve Asset Utilization
- Increase equipment uptime
- Implement predictive maintenance
- Optimize inventory levels
- Repurpose underutilized assets
-
Leverage Tax Benefits
- Take advantage of depreciation schedules
- Utilize R&D tax credits
- Explore government incentives for certain industries
- Structure investments for optimal tax treatment
-
Mitigate Risks
- Diversify revenue sources
- Implement contingency plans
- Secure appropriate insurance coverage
- Conduct thorough market research
10. ROI Calculation Best Practices
Follow these professional recommendations for accurate and actionable ROI calculations:
- Use Conservative Estimates: Base your calculations on realistic, achievable numbers rather than best-case scenarios.
- Include All Costs: Account for direct, indirect, and opportunity costs in your analysis.
- Consider the Full Lifecycle: Evaluate costs and benefits from implementation through disposal.
- Adjust for Inflation: Use real (inflation-adjusted) cash flows for long-term projects.
- Document Assumptions: Clearly record all assumptions made in your calculations for transparency.
- Update Regularly: Revisit your ROI calculations periodically as actual data becomes available.
- Compare Alternatives: Always evaluate ROI in the context of other potential investments.
- Present Clearly: Use visualizations and executive summaries to communicate results effectively.
- Consider Qualitative Factors: Some benefits (brand reputation, customer satisfaction) may not be quantifiable but are still valuable.
- Get Independent Review: Have your calculations reviewed by a financial professional for validation.
11. Common ROI Calculation Tools and Templates
These resources can help streamline your ROI calculations:
- Excel Templates:
- Microsoft Office ROI Calculator Template
- Vertex42 ROI Analysis Template
- Excel Easy NPV and IRR Calculator
- Online Calculators:
- Calculator.net ROI Calculator
- Bankrate Investment Calculator
- NerdWallet Business Loan Calculator
- Software Solutions:
- QuickBooks Advanced (for small businesses)
- Oracle NetSuite (for enterprise ROI analysis)
- SAP Analytics Cloud (for large organizations)
- Mobile Apps:
- ROI Calculator Pro (iOS/Android)
- Financial Calculators by Bishinews
- Investing.com Portfolio Manager
12. The Future of ROI Analysis
Emerging trends are transforming how organizations calculate and utilize ROI:
- AI-Powered Forecasting: Machine learning algorithms can analyze vast datasets to predict cash flows with greater accuracy.
- Real-Time ROI Tracking: Cloud-based systems now allow for continuous monitoring of project performance against ROI projections.
- Integrated ESG Metrics: Environmental, Social, and Governance factors are increasingly being incorporated into ROI calculations.
- Predictive Analytics: Advanced statistical models can identify patterns and risks that traditional methods might miss.
- Blockchain for Transparency: Distributed ledger technology is being used to create auditable records of investment performance.
- Scenario Modeling: Sophisticated tools allow for instant “what-if” analysis across thousands of variables.
- Automated Reporting: Natural language generation tools can automatically create narrative reports from ROI data.
- Collaborative Platforms: Cloud-based systems enable real-time collaboration on ROI analysis across departments and geographies.
13. ROI Calculation Case Studies
Examining real-world examples provides valuable insights into effective ROI analysis:
-
Amazon’s AWS Investment
- Initial Investment: $3-5 billion annually in infrastructure
- ROI Challenge: High upfront costs with long payback period
- Result: AWS now generates over $80 billion in annual revenue with 30%+ margins
- Key Lesson: Patient capital and long-term vision can yield exceptional returns
-
Tesla’s Gigafactory
- Initial Investment: $5 billion for Nevada Gigafactory
- ROI Drivers: Economies of scale in battery production
- Result: Reduced battery costs by 30%, enabling mass-market EVs
- Key Lesson: Vertical integration can create competitive advantages that boost ROI
-
Netflix’s Shift to Streaming
- Initial Investment: $1 billion+ in content and technology
- ROI Risk: Cannibalizing existing DVD rental business
- Result: 230+ million subscribers, $30 billion market cap
- Key Lesson: Disruptive innovation requires bold ROI calculations that account for market transformation
-
Walmart’s E-commerce Expansion
- Initial Investment: $11 billion in e-commerce acquisitions and technology
- ROI Challenge: Competing with Amazon’s head start
- Result: 40%+ e-commerce growth, omnichannel synergies
- Key Lesson: Omnichannel strategies can create ROI multipliers
14. ROI Calculation FAQs
Answers to common questions about calculating return on investment:
-
Q: What’s the difference between ROI and ROE?
A: ROI (Return on Investment) measures the return on any investment, while ROE (Return on Equity) specifically measures returns to shareholders’ equity. ROI is broader and can be applied to any project or asset.
-
Q: Should I use simple ROI or annualized ROI?
A: For projects longer than one year, always use annualized ROI to account for the time value of money. Simple ROI can be misleading for multi-year projects.
-
Q: How do I account for inflation in ROI calculations?
A: You can either: (1) Use nominal cash flows with a nominal discount rate, or (2) Use real cash flows (inflation-adjusted) with a real discount rate. Both methods should give similar results.
-
Q: What discount rate should I use?
A: The discount rate should reflect your opportunity cost of capital. For corporations, this is typically the Weighted Average Cost of Capital (WACC). For individuals, it might be your expected return from alternative investments.
-
Q: How do I calculate ROI for a project with irregular cash flows?
A: Use the XIRR function in Excel or financial software, which can handle irregular intervals between cash flows. This gives you the internal rate of return for non-periodic cash flows.
-
Q: What’s a good ROI percentage?
A: This depends on your industry and risk profile. Generally:
- 10-20%: Solid return for established businesses
- 20-30%: Excellent return
- 30%+: Outstanding, but may indicate higher risk
- Below 10%: May not be worth the investment unless strategic
-
Q: How do I calculate ROI for a marketing campaign?
A: Marketing ROI = (Incremental Revenue Attributable to Campaign – Cost of Campaign) / Cost of Campaign × 100%. Be sure to account for customer lifetime value, not just immediate sales.
-
Q: Can ROI be negative?
A: Yes, a negative ROI means the investment lost money. This is common in the early stages of long-term projects or in failed ventures.
-
Q: How often should I recalculate ROI?
A: For ongoing projects, recalculate ROI:
- Quarterly for short-term projects
- Annually for long-term projects
- Whenever there are significant changes in assumptions
- Before making additional investments in the project
-
Q: What’s the relationship between ROI and risk?
A: Generally, higher potential ROI comes with higher risk. Use risk-adjusted ROI metrics like Sharpe ratio or Sortino ratio to account for volatility in your returns.
15. Final Thoughts on Project ROI Calculation
Calculating ROI for a project is both an art and a science. While the mathematical calculations are straightforward, the real challenge lies in:
- Making accurate projections about future cash flows
- Accounting for all relevant costs and benefits
- Selecting appropriate discount rates that reflect risk
- Presenting the results in a way that drives good decision-making
Remember that ROI is just one metric in your decision-making toolkit. Always consider it alongside other factors like strategic alignment, competitive positioning, and qualitative benefits. The most successful organizations use ROI as a starting point for discussion, not as the sole decision criterion.
By mastering the techniques outlined in this guide and applying them consistently, you’ll be able to make more informed investment decisions, secure funding for worthwhile projects, and ultimately drive greater value for your organization.